Undertaking a project effectively hinges on the ability to estimate its outcome with accuracy. Accurate forecasting allows stakeholders to assign resources wisely, manage risks, and set realistic schedules. To achieve this goal, a comprehensive system is essential.
- First, assess the project's scope, identifying key deliverables and milestones.
- Subsequently, collect historical data from similar projects to influence your estimates.
- Additionally, include potential risks and develop contingency plans.
By following these guidelines, you can enhance your project forecasting abilities, paving the way for triumphant project outcomes.

Unveiling Project Costs: Strategic Forecasting for Budget Control
Effective project management hinges on the skill to accurately forecast costs. By implementing strategic forecasting methods, organizations can achieve a crystal-clear understanding of potential expenses throughout the project lifecycle. This proactive approach empowers teams to successfully manage budgets, reduce risks associated with cost overruns, website and ultimately deliver projects within specified financial constraints.
A well-defined forecasting process incorporates meticulous assessment of historical data, present market conditions, and anticipated project scope changes. This thorough analysis facilitates the development of realistic cost estimates, furnishing a robust foundation for budget planning and control.
Furthermore, strategic forecasting promotes continuous monitoring and revision of budgets based on current project progress. This dynamic approach affords organizations the flexibility to react unforeseen challenges and maximize resource allocation throughout the project lifecycle.
Navigating Uncertainty: Risk Assessment and Forecasting in Projects
In the dynamic realm of project management, fluidity is an inherent characteristic that demands meticulous navigation. Diligently assessing potential risks and developing robust forecasting models are paramount to ensuring project success. By carefully identifying potential threats, analyzing their impact, and implementing mitigation strategies, project teams can minimize the adverse consequences of unforeseen events. Furthermore, precise forecasting enables informed decision-making by providing incisive insights into future project trajectories.
A well-structured risk assessment process involves recognizing potential risks through brainstorming sessions, historical data analysis, and expert opinions. Subsequently, each identified risk is evaluated based on its potential of occurrence and its severity should it materialize. This evaluation allows for the categorization of risks, enabling project managers to devote resources effectively to mitigating the most critical threats.
Ultimately, constructing a robust forecasting model involves incorporating historical data, statistical analysis, and expert judgment to predict future project outcomes. By monitoring key performance indicators (KPIs) and modifying the forecast as needed, project teams can guarantee a high level of accuracy and adaptability in the face of changing circumstances.
